Understanding Wattage in Cordless Vacuum Cleaners

Wattage is often regarded as a vital indicator of a vacuum cleaner’s performance. It essentially refers to the amount of power the vacuum consumes when it’s in operation. However, wattage alone does not directly translate to cleaning effectiveness or suction power. This can lead to confusion among consumers.

What Wattage Means for Cordless Vacuums

Strong wattage typically indicates that a vacuum cleaner can deliver more power, which can result in improved suction capability. In the world of cordless vacuums, you will generally find models with a wattage range from 50W to 400W.

  • Low Wattage (50W to 100W): These models may be sufficient for light cleaning tasks, like quick pick-ups or maintaining a tidy home. However, they may struggle with deep cleaning carpets or handling larger debris.

  • Medium Wattage (100W to 300W): A vacuum in this range offers a good mix of power and efficiency. It’s capable of efficiently handling everyday messes, pet hair, and dust on different surfaces.

  • High Wattage (300W and above): Models that reach or exceed 400W are often considered high-performance tools. They are designed for heavy-duty cleaning and can tackle stubborn dirt and larger debris, making them ideal for households with pets or kids.

Factors Influencing Suction Power Beyond Wattage

While higher wattage is usually favorable, other factors come into play concerning suction power:

  • Motor Technology: The design and efficiency of the motor can significantly affect performance. Brushless motors, for instance, convert electrical energy into mechanical energy more efficiently, offering better suction power at lower wattages.

  • Airflow: This is the volume of air that moves through the vacuum. A model with high airflow can often compensate for lower wattage, ensuring that dirt and debris are removed effectively.

  • Design and Seal: The construction of the vacuum, including its seals and attachments, also plays a crucial role. A well-designed vacuum minimizes loss of suction through leaks and allows for more efficient dirt pickup.

Battery Life Considerations

Another crucial factor to keep in mind is battery life, which directly impacts the usability of a cordless vacuum cleaner.

How Wattage Affects Battery Life

Higher wattage vacuums typically consume more battery power, which can lead to shorter cleaning times. However, advancements in battery technology have led to the development of models that can provide longer runtimes despite higher power. Most modern cordless vacuums offer 20 to 40 minutes of cleaning time on a full charge, but this can decrease significantly if you are using high power modes.

Types of Batteries

There are various types of batteries used in cordless vacuums which affect both performance and longevity:

  • Nickel-Cadmium (NiCd): This older technology is heavier and can have memory effects, leading to shorter battery life over time.

  • Nickel-Metal Hydride (NiMH): Offers better performance than NiCd but can be prone to discharge if not used regularly.

  • Lithium-Ion (Li-Ion): The most popular choice for modern vacuums, providing longer runtimes, less weight, and no memory effect.

How does suction power relate to wattage?

Suction power is directly related to wattage, but the relationship is not always straightforward. Higher wattage typically generates more energy for suction, but it also depends on the vacuum’s design and motor efficiency. Therefore, two vacuums with similar wattage can have different suction performance due to variations in technology and build quality.

<pMoreover, suction power is often measured in air watts, which accounts for airflow and suction combined, providing a more accurate assessment of performance. When comparing vacuums, it is also worthwhile to check the air watts if available, as this will give you a clearer picture of the cleaner’s effective suction capabilities.
